Os materiais porosos também podem ser empregados em combinações selecionadas para otimizar o desempenho da fratura ou do controle de areia e/ou podem ser empregados como materiais de peso relativamente leve em sistemas de tratamento de poço à base de dióxido de carbono líquido."PROCESS FOR TREATMENT OF UNDERGROUND FORMATIONS WITH PARTICULAR POROUS CERAMIC MATERIALS". Processes and compositions useful for underground formation treatments such as hydraulic fracture and sand control treatments that include porous materials. Such porous materials may also be particles of selectively configured particulate porous material and / or treated with selected glazing materials, coating materials and / or penetrating materials to have the desired strength and / or apparent density to adapt to particular downhole conditions to well treatment such as hydraulic fracture treatments and sand control treatments. Porous materials may also be employed in selected combinations to optimize fracture or sand control performance and / or may be employed as relatively light weight materials in liquid carbon dioxide-based well treatment systems.
